Chapin
A premier lakeside residence in Chapin has been listed for $2.5 million, offering potential buyers luxurious amenities and breathtaking views of Lake Murray. The property, located at 249 Pointe Overlook Drive, boasts a spacious 5,123 square feet of living space, highlighting the modern architectural style since its completion in 2019.
The residence comprises five bedrooms and includes two full kitchens designed for both practicality and elegance. The interior features vaulted wood ceilings and wide-plank hardwood floors, complemented by hand-selected marble countertops that reflect contemporary design standards. Entertainment options in the home are plentiful with a full theater room and a billiards room, ensuring activities for guests and family alike.
Outside, the property is equipped with a saltwater pool, multiple outdoor entertaining areas—including an upper-story deck and a ground-floor covered patio—and offers curated landscape lighting to enhance evening gatherings. For boating enthusiasts, there’s a private watercraft port, dock, and a fish cleaning station, featuring a 12,000-pound boat lift for effortless dockage.
Spanning 0.33 acres, the lot includes 24 feet of water depth providing ample space for water activities while enjoying panoramic views of Lake Murray and occasional sights of downtown Columbia.
Market Insights
Listing agent Ashley McDonald from Compass Carolinas is handling the property sale amid a dynamic market. Recent neighborhood sales indicate strong demand. A comparable five-bedroom home on Chimney Hill Road recently sold for $2.1 million, showcasing the area’s investment potential and desirability.
Broader Market Developments
This lakeside property acquisition comes amidst broader commercial real estate changes in the Columbia area. The Lake Murray Golf Center at 2032 Old Hilton Road has changed ownership, with plans for development phased over the coming months including a driving range and later a full-service restaurant. The neighborhood commercial venue 911 Lady Street is now fully occupied, welcoming new tenants such as Open House Yoga and Gilbane Building Company.
Columbia’s economic landscape is also changing, with population growth showing signs of slowing, which affects speculative industrial construction rates. Despite this, the city maintains a 6.9% vacancy rate, below the national average. Federal and state investments in electric vehicle initiatives are projected to increase market demand.
Residential Development Trends
On the residential front, Pulte Homes is set to introduce Monroe Preserve, a new community near Lake Murray that will feature 80 planned homes with customizable designs starting in the mid-$300,000 range. This development indicates continued growth and interest in the region.
